Hi. I need an LIVE AUDIO STREAM player in native flash without using any kind of embedded WMP , QuickTime, ...

I will provide all graphics in PSD files. Player itself will be small (about 200×200 pixels) and will have 5 buttons – play, stop, mute, volume up and volume down.

It must plays LIVE AUDIO STREAM – MP3 or AAC . My web page will use JavaScript to dynamic stream url change (we have 4 different audio streams at this moment) without reloading flash object. My web page should be able to mute / unmute the player (also using JavaScript call). Player should be able to remember (cookies) last volume, so it can restore it when visitors comes back. I can’t use FLEX server or anything like that. I have working audio streams in WMA and I can start streams in MP3 , AAC or OGG (not preferred) formats.

You can use these streams for testing (as we will use the same server and configuration): http://www.play.cz/radio/danceradio128.aac.m3u http://www.play.cz/radio/danceradio128.mp3.m3u

ShoutCast streams are relayed from a media player to a server which in turn handles the streams that listener connect to. So everyone who listens takes bandwidth from the server and not the computer that runs the radio station.
